Transaction ac8634195b2d37f760253b8947a7abc835833570019d04b646d43a9ef2427975

4 Input
2 Outputs
  • ac8634195b2d37f760253b8947a7abc835833570019d04b646d43a9ef2427975:0
  • value  37615457
    address  3FabuZCjtwi9uMVWYjLWfCEeoY5zAu1KDF
  • ac8634195b2d37f760253b8947a7abc835833570019d04b646d43a9ef2427975:1
  • value  13924
    address  3BMEXjK3oA3qCYpNaPE2BMPcT2co54Geby